The UCLA Ed&IS Department of Information Studies stands as a leader in this critically important discipline. Shaping the framework for 21st-century information distribution and application, we champion barrier-free access as a catalyst for remarkable achievements and a more just society.

This Department houses UCLA's iSchool, part of a global network focused on progressing information-related fields. iSchools emphasize cross-disciplinary methods to address both the possibilities and complexities of information systems, grounded in fundamental principles such as equitable access and information organization centered around user needs.

IELTS 7.0 TOEFL IBT 87 TOEFL PBT 560 All of the following items must be uploaded to the appropriate area of the online application Statement of purpose Rsum or CV Evidence of research and writing This could be published work a masters thesis or two research papers written in English Three letters of recommendation You must enter the names and other information about your recommenders in the online application Fellowship application Review the criteria for each fellowship and if you are qualified complete the appropriate sections One copy of official transcript from all academic institutions you have attended beyond secondary school Admission to a graduate program at UCLA requires that applicants hold a bachelors degree from a universitylevel institution and in addition have at the minimum achieved a B 3.0 grade point average or its equivalent in the last 60 semesterunits or last 90 quarterunits of undergraduate work Applicants to the PhD program in Information Studies may enter with the MLS or MLIS degree other advanced degree or directly out of a bachelors degree program If the prior graduate degree does not include coursework equivalent to the core identified for the MLIS program the applicant must complete the MLIS core after admission to the PhD program A minimum 3.0 cumulative GPA will be required for admission to graduate programs at UCLA
